Output 862b887016b23042d92515340c9f3b945a1e16afd5d00c4cb243c0f33d450b43:0

value
43999218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4da32cccc0aa67a98e9183f73e0a9eb058bfb59 OP_EQUAL
address
3KdskqRfdQMsgHUPa2nvqBRYhssHrAWtEb
transaction
862b887016b23042d92515340c9f3b945a1e16afd5d00c4cb243c0f33d450b43
spent
true